Joe sends Sanjay an offer via email from his Toronto office. The offer contains a provision indicating that the offer expires at 5:00 p.m. Toronto time. Sanjay, who lives in Vancouver, replies and accepts Joe's offer at 4:00 p.m. Vancouver time. Joe receives Sanjay's email acceptance at 9:00 a.m. the next day. Which of the following statements is true? (Note the three-hour time difference between Toronto and Vancouver.)
◦ A binding contract had been formed, once Joe opened Sanjay's email acceptance the next day.
◦ Joe's offer had expired.
◦ The contract became binding once Joe made the offer.
◦ Once Sanjay sent the email, a binding contract had been formed regardless of what time Joe received the email.
◦ Joe and Sanjay had a binding contract, since Sanjay had accepted by 4:00 p.m. Vancouver time.
